body {

margin: 0px;

padding: 0px;

background-color: #000;

font-family: Arial, Helvetica, Verdana;

font-weight: normal;

font-size: 12px;

}


a {

color: #1b1885;

text-decoration: none;

}


a:active {

color: #1b1885;

text-decoration: none;

}


a:visited {

color: #1b1885;

text-decoration: none;

} 


a:hover {

color: #fff;

text-decoration: underline;

}


p { 

color: #fff;

text-align: justify;

line-height: 150%;

padding: 0px; /*----- paragraph padding -----*/

}


.center {

margin-left: auto;

margin-right: auto;

}


div.scroller { 

width: 780px; /*----- width of visible scoller area -----*/

height: 280px;

overflow: hidden;

border:0px solid #ccc;

}


div.scroller div.section {

width: 800px;

height: 280px;

overflow:hidden;

float:left;

padding:1em;

}


div.scroller div.content {

width: 10000px;

}


.opacity {

opacity: 0.07;

filter: alpha(opacity=10);

}


#biopic {

float: left;

}


#biotext { 

float: left;

width: 400px;

text-align: justify;

padding-left: 20px; 

line-height: 150%;

color: #333;

}


#contact {

margin-top: 0px;

}


#container {

width: 1080px;

height: 640px;

background-image: url(../img/bgmain.jpg);

background-color: #4D668f; 

margin-top: 0px;

padding: 0px;

}


#content {

float: left;

width: 505px;

height: 340px;

margin: 0px;

padding-left: 30px;

font-size: 13px;

}


#title {

float: left;

width: 350px;

height: 70px;

margin: 0px;

padding: 2px 0px 0px 22px;

}



/*----- BEGIN GALLERY -----*/


#FrogJS {

float: left;

width: 570px;

height: 313px;

margin: 15px 0px 0px 15px;

color: #333;

line-height: 140%;

border: 1px;

}

#FrogJSCredit {

text-align: right;

font-size: 80%;

color: #999;

padding: 1px;

}

#FrogJSCaption {

text-align: left;

line-height: 140%;

}

/*----- END GALLERY -----*/



#page {

width: 590px;

height: 640px;

margin-top: 0px;

padding: 0px;

}



/*----- BEGIN TOP NAV -----*/

#nav {

float: left;

width: 500px;

height: 35px; 

margin-left: 16px;

padding: 0px;

}


#nav ul {

list-style-type: none;

float: left;

width: 500px;

height: 35px; /*-----  height and width same as #nav container -----*/

margin: 0px;

padding: 0px;

}


#nav li {

display: inline;

line-height: 240%; /*----- vertical text adjustment for nav list -----*/

margin: 0px;

padding: 20px 11px 8px 11px;

}


#nav li.catoff {

font-family: helvetica, arial, sans-serif; 

font-size: 12px; 

color: #fff;

}
	

#nav li.catoff a {

text-decoration:none;

color: #fff;

}


#nav li.caton {

background-color:#6D83A7;

font-family: helvetica, arial, sans-serif; 

font-size: 12px; 

color: #fff;

}


#nav li.caton a {

text-decoration:none;

color: #fff;

}

/*----- END TOP NAV -----*/


#subtitle {

float: left;

width: 140px;

height: 20px;

margin: 0px;

padding: 45px 0px 0px 20px;

}


#text {

margin-left: auto;

margin-right: auto;

}





